/SEHS/BA_MISC1220 - Details

  • The SAP error message /SEHS/BA_MISC1220 indicates that an identifier (such as a name, code, or key) exceeds the maximum allowed length defined in the system. This typically occurs in scenarios where identifiers are expected to conform to specific length constraints, and the provided identifier exceeds that limit.
    
    Cause: Identifier Length Exceeded: The primary cause of this error is that the identifier you are trying to use is longer than the maximum length allowed by the system. This could be due to user input, data import, or system-generated identifiers. Configuration Settings: The maximum length for identifiers may be defined in the system configuration, and if the identifier you are using does not comply with these settings, the error will be triggered.
